Priscilla Wright
A Celebration of Life services for Ms. Priscilla A. Wright will be held Wednesday, November 19, 2025 at 1:00 o’clock P. M. in the William Grove Baptist Church, 104 West Mary Street, Dublin, Georgia. The Pastor, Rev. Johnathan Lewis will officiate, and the interment will follow in the Dudley Memorial Cemetery. Priscilla Ann Wright was born July 26, 1964, in Dublin, Laurens County, Georgia. She was the 3rd child of 13 born to Lee and Ada Mae Allen Wright, who both preceded her in death. She was a graduate of Dublin High School and attended Georgia College. Priscilla was called home by her Heavenly Father on Friday, November 14, 2025. Priscilla was a matter-of-fact woman who spoke firmly and stood her ground. She lived a private life, enjoying her family, especially her nieces and nephews. As the “family educator”, she ensured all her nieces and nephews were eager to go when it was time for school. She was known to sing her special song of love to them also. Although, she did not have children of her own, she mothered her nieces and nephews as her own with love-filled activities and discipline. She was an avid reader and liked watching movies. Priscilla also enjoyed cheering on and supporting the Dublin Fighting Irish football and basketball teams. For almost 30 years, Priscilla was a devoted and faithful employee with Dublin City Schools. She was a member of William Grove Baptist Church, where she enjoyed praising the Lord and growing her faith.
